If youre rich, you might be on MySpace
2008-03-12 16:59:56 by GadgetManiac in GadgetManiac
 

Luxury Institute reports that participation in social networking websites by the wealthy has doubled in 2008. Apparently 60% of those with an average income/net-worth worth of $287,000/2,100,000, were busy chating, messaging and emailing their online buds, or so sez Luxury Institute, anyway. Sixteen percent use MySpace, 13% use LinkedIn with 11% for Facebook.

…the LuxInst numbers seem somewhat high, as one would have expected such individuals to be preoccupied with their underperforming portfolios and CDOs in these sub-prime times.

Other tidbits from LI includes the fact that the rich prefer Vacheron Constantin over Patek Philippe and Piaget, they like Lexus ahead of Infiniti and Acura and for education they rate MIT tops with Harvard and Yale at second and third.
